



Neil Sedaka
- Neil once had his very own television special on NBC titled, "Neil Sedaka Steppin' Out" in 1976
- Neil moved to England in 1970 to work on his comeback. While there, he worked with British music artist Elton John, whom helped Neil re-record some of his British music for U.S. release.
- Like many other American music artists, Neil lost much of his popularity to the British Invasion of the early 60's. Because of this, Neil concentrated on his songwriting instead of performing and wrote hit songs for Tom Jones and The Fifth Dimension.
- Neil's first major record contract was with RCA records.
- Neil is of Caucasian descent
- In 1983, Neil was inducted into the Songwriters Hall of Fame.
